Effective as of: August 22, 2019

1. The Spotify Premium Student Tier Introductory Trial Offer.
The Spotify Premium Student Tier Introductory Trial Offer (the “Student Intro Offer”) is made to you by Spotify (as defined in the Spotify Terms and Conditions of Use, “Spotify Terms of Use”). The Student Intro Offer allows you, subject to these terms and conditions (the “Student Intro Offer Terms”), to access the Spotify Premium Service (as defined in the Spotify Terms of Use) for an initial trial period of up to three (3) months (the “Student Intro Offer Period”) at the advertised price; after you subscribe to the Student Intro Offer by completing your payment. During the Student Intro Offer Period, Spotify may, from time-to-time, make available certain Partner Services, as defined in the Spotify Premium for Students Tier Terms and Conditions (“Student Tier Terms”), to subscribers to the Student Intro Offer.

30 Day Free Trial Spotify Premium

By submitting your payment details, (i) you accept these Student Intro Offer Terms which supplement and incorporate by reference the Student Tier Terms, (ii) consent to us using your payment details in accordance with our Privacy Policy, (iii) acknowledge and agree to the Spotify Terms of Use. If there is any inconsistency between these Student Intro Offer Terms and the Student Tier Terms, these Student Intro Offer Terms will prevail.

2. Eligibility.
In order to receive this Student Intro Offer you must be a Qualifying Student (as defined in the Student Tier Terms) and satisfy the eligibility requirements in the Student Tier Terms. To verify your status as a Qualifying Student, you must submit your Qualifying Information (as defined in the Student Tier Terms) by following the steps outlined in the Student Tier Terms. We may use the services of SheerID, Inc., to process and report to us on your Qualifying Information, as described in the Student Tier Terms.

You must also be a new subscriber to the Spotify Premium Service. If you have subscribed to the Premium or Unlimited service or have taken a 30-day free trial offer or a 3-month free trial offer previously, you are ineligible for this Student Intro Offer. You may also be ineligible for this Student Intro Offer if you have taken other previous trial offers offered by Spotify. Only one Student Intro Offer may be applied to each Spotify Premium account. You may only redeem the Student Intro Offer once.

3. Duration.
After the Student Intro Offer Period, you will automatically be charged the then-current monthly price of the Student Tier (as defined in the Student Tier Terms) and the payment method you provided will automatically be charged that amount, unless you cancel your Premium Service subscription prior to the end of the Student Intro Offer Period. To cancel, you must log into your Spotify account and follow the prompts on the Account page or click here and follow the instructions.

In the event that you become a paying subscriber to the Student Tier after the Student Intro Offer Period has ended, the first Discount Period (as defined in the Student Tier Terms) remaining under your then current Student Tier subscription will be reduced by three (3) months. As a result, you will be asked to re-verify your eligibility as a Qualifying Student nine (9) months after that subscription begins.

This Student Intro Offer must be redeemed before the date advertised (if any). Except where prohibited by applicable law, Spotify reserves the right to modify, waive or earlier terminate this Student Intro Offer at any time and for any reason. After such time of termination, Spotify shall not be obligated to allow any further redemption of Student Intro Offers.

4. Partner Services.
In order to receive access to any Partner Services that we may make available, you must follow the steps outlined in the Student Tier Terms. The Partner Services will have their own terms of use which will apply. Certain Partner Services may have additional eligibility conditions which, if applicable, we will outline in the Student Tier Terms.

Spotify is now available in India. Here’s how to get started with the long-awaited music streaming application.

Spotify is now finally available for Indian users. The official application is available for download on Google's Play Store and Apple's App Store. It's also available on desktop for Windows and MacOS.

Spotify, one of the world's biggest music streaming services, has been making efforts to tap markets outside the US. India has been one of its priority markets. The company, however, has made some changes to woo the Indian audience. For instance, its subscription plans are much cheaper in India than what it charges users in the US.

Spotify will offer more than four crore songs and 300 crore playlists for music fans in the country, the company said.

It had briefly hit a hurdle when the music label, WMG, filed for an injunction in the Bombay High Court earlier this week over licensing rights.

'Not only will Spotify bring Indian artists to the world, we'll also bring the world's music to fans across India. Spotify's music family just got a whole lot bigger,' said Daniel Ek, Spotify Founder and CEO.

The free version of Spotify offers unlimited access to content which covers India-specific genres such as Bollywood, Punjabi, Tamil and Telugu along with international music. Spotify is integrated with other platforms like smart speakers, Google Maps, Tinder and Instagram. In total, the streaming app is compatible with over 500 products across 200 hardware brands.

To subscribe for the premium version, iPhone users in India to visit the official Spotify website. Android users can sign up for the premium version from the application. Some users are facing issues with the Android app, though. If you face the same issue, simply visit the official website to get started with the premium version.

Spotify Premium: Subscription plans

Spotify premium offers ad-free unlimited music, podcasts and offline support. In India, Spotify is offering a 30-day free trial for Spotify Premium after which it will start charging 119 a month. Spotify is also offering recharge-like top-up options which start as low as 13 for 1 day. Users can pay for these top-up recharges via Paytm.

The top-up plans are 39 for seven days, 129 for one month, 389 for three months, and 719 for six months.

The annual subscription plan is priced at 1,189. Students can avail up to 50% discount on monthly subscription.

Spotify vs competition (premium version)

Apple Music is available for monthly subscription rate of 120. Student plans start at 60. Google's Play Music is available for 99 per month. Saavn offers a premium Saavn Pro at a starting subscription plan of 95. Wynk Music, which is mostly bundled with several Airtel plans, is available for 120 per month.
